#»» 5 - (warning !) • If you uses this ipfilter, you will know this:
#> 10.0.0.0-10.255.255.255, 127.0.0.0-127.255.255.255,
# 172.16.0.0-172.31.255.255 and 192.168.0.0-192.168.255.255 are (not by eMule) filtered.
# It's the LanCast[LN] feature of eMule and it have the level 160. Be careful without eMule.
#> "MultiCast" ranges are filtered.
#> Somes ED2K servers will be filtered when you update the ED2K server list.
#> This IPFilter would be not used with a firewall...some many web site will be filtered.
#> You can adjust the level of IPFilter.dat in eMule (default: all numbers before 127 are filtered)
#» 	060 	= 	[BG]	= 	Unallocated Address Space on IPv4.
#» 	070 	= 	[BG]	= 	Bogus AS Advertisements.
#» 	080 	= 	[BG]	= 	Possible Bogus Routes.
#» 	090 	= 	[L1]	= 	Level1.
#» 	095 	= 	[FK]	=	Fake Server.
#» 	097 	= 	[MS]	= 	Microsoft.
#» 	107 	= 	[PT]	= 	Tor, proxy list
#» 	109 	= 	[L2]	= 	Level2.
#» 	111 	= 	[SW]	= 	Spyware.
#» 	113 	= 	[AD]	= 	Ad Trackers.
#» 	115 	= 	[SD]	= 	Spider.
#» 	119 	= 	[TL]	= 	TempList.
#» 	160 	= 	[LN]	= 	Lan range.
# Example: if you wants filtered all except L2 & SW & AD & SD & TL & LN, you must set 108.
# -------- if you wants filtered only Bogon, you must set 80.
# more you decreases level in eMule, more the security of IPFilter decreases.

Posted 01 January 2009 - 03:58 PM

View Postloverboy, on Dec 31 2008, 08:26 PM, said:

Where is the difference?
The principal one:
v132
You can set a level of filtered (default: 127)
Ozzy.311208
it has not filtered level (all ip ranges are filtered)

Others:
Ozzy.311208 hasn´t got a Changelog for what we cannot know more on this version

From the Stulle's explanation ;

Quote

New IPFilter:

* The original IPFilter maintained via the Pawcio mirror becomes update fewer and fewer so I decided to change the provider to another, hopefully more reliable, source.
* Henceforth will the default IPFilter be maintained by Ozzy and indipendently distributed via the ScarAngel project site on Sourceforge.
* New versions will be checked via a dyndns service quite alike the version check.
* To reduce the overall traffic when updating I decided to use WinRAR compression so the unrar.dll from the binary package is required!
* The new IPFilter will not interfere with other mirrors as it only uses the new methods when the default mirror is chosen.

Posted 07 January 2009 - 04:37 PM

~ NFL
The same doubt arose in the corresponding Spanish thread.
Translated:

View PostR3Qu13M, on Jan 2 2009, 03:37 PM, said:

It´s not an any problem, is usual when some ip ranges coincide, only that it differes for the filtered level correspondent.
Look the Changelog & you´ll see the mention to your question:

Changelog said:

#»» Parsed lines/entries:258537 Found IP ranges:258537 Duplicate:0 Merged:33
258537 - 33 = 258504 ;)
